AN ACT MAKING AN ADDITIONAL APPROPRIATION OF CAPITAL EXPENSE FUNDS AND SPECIAL FUNDS FOR FISCAL YEARS 2024 AND 2025 TO DEFRAY THE EXPENSES OF THE MISSISSIPPI STATE BOARD OF DENTAL EXAMINERS; THE MISSISSIPPI DEVELOPMENT AUTHORITY; THE WIRELESS COMMUNICATION COMMISSION; THE STATE BOARD OF COSMETOLOGY; THE GOVERNOR'S OFFICE-DIVISION OF MEDICAID; THE STATE FORESTRY COMMISSION; THE OFFICE OF THE ATTORNEY GENERAL; THE SECRETARY OF STATE; THE MISSISSIPPI DEPARTMENT OF EDUCATION; THE MISSISSIPPI STATE DEPARTMENT OF HEALTH; AND FOR RELATED PURPOSES.

SECTION 1.  In addition to all other sums herein appropriated, the following sum, or so much thereof as may be necessary, is appropriated out of any money in the State Treasury to the credit of the Mississippi State Board of Dental Examiners and allocated in a manner as determined by the Treasurer's Office, to defray the expenses of the Mississippi State Board of Dental Examiners for the period beginning upon passage, and ending June 30, 2025....................... $     320,000.00.

     This additional appropriation is for the purpose of defraying the costs of relocating the agency, facility inspections, and replacing the agency's database system.

SECTION 2.  In addition to all other sums herein appropriated, the following sum, or so much thereof as may be necessary, is appropriated out of any money in the State Treasury to the credit of the Mississippi Development Authority and allocated in a manner as determined by the Treasurer's Office, to defray the expenses of the Mississippi Development Authority for the period beginning July 1, 2023, and ending June 30, 2024...........................................................

.............................................. $   5,000,000.00.

     This additional appropriation is for the purpose of defraying the cost of the Forestry Facility Grant Program established in Section 57-1-781, Mississippi Code of 1972.

SECTION 3. In addition to all other sums herein appropriated, the following sum, or so much thereof as may be necessary, is appropriated out of any money in the State Treasury to the credit of the Wireless Communication Commission and allocated in a manner as determined by the Treasurer's Office, to defray the expenses of the Wireless Communication Commission for the period beginning upon passage, and ending June 30, 2025...........................................................

.............................................. $   3,900,000.00.

     This additional appropriation is for the purpose of defraying the cost associated with adding new statewide communication towers.

SECTION 4.  In addition to all other sums herein appropriated, the following sum, or so much thereof as may be necessary, is appropriated out of any money in the State Treasury, to the credit of the State Board of Cosmetology, and allocated in a manner as determined by the Treasurer's Office, to defray the expenses of the State Board of Cosmetology for the period beginning July 1, 2023, and ending June 30, 2024...........................................................

.............................................. $      57,000.00.

     This additional appropriation is for the purpose of defraying agency operational expenditures.

SECTION 5.  In addition to all other sums herein appropriated, the following sum, or so much thereof as may be necessary, is appropriated out of any money in the State Treasury, to the credit of the Governor's Office-Division of Medicaid, and allocated in a manner as determined by the Treasurer's Office, to defray the expenses of the Governor's Office-Division of Medicaid for the period beginning July 1, 2023, and ending June 30, 2024..................................................

.............................................. $ 855,218,476.00.

     This additional appropriation is for the purpose of defraying mandated Medicaid medical services.

SECTION 6.  In addition to all other sums herein appropriated, the following sum, or so much thereof as may be necessary, is appropriated out of any money in the State Treasury, to the credit of the State Forestry Commission, and allocated in a manner as determined by the Treasurer's Office, to defray the expenses of the State Forestry Commission for the period beginning July 1, 2023, and ending June 30, 2024.......................................... $     719,405.00.

     This additional appropriation is for the purpose of defraying expenses related to the emergency response to wildfires.

SECTION 7.  In addition to all other sums herein appropriated, the following sum, or so much thereof as may be necessary, is appropriated out of any money to the credit of the Capital Expense Fund, and allocated in a manner as determined by the Treasurer's Office, to defray the expenses of paying for certain outside legal assistance, expert witness fees, court fees, judgments and settlement agreements incurred by the Office of the Attorney General for the period beginning upon passage, and ending June 30, 2025........................... $     665,094.00.

(a)  Anthony Fox v. State of Mississippi, Circuit Court of Hinds County, Mississippi, Cause No. 24-188........... $       57,562.00

(b)  Mississippi State Conference of the National Conference for the Advancement of Colored People, et al. v. State Board of Election Commissioners, et al. No. 3:22-cv-734 (S.D. Miss)................

.............................................. $      607,532.00

SECTION 8.  In addition to all other sums herein appropriated, the following sum, or so much thereof as may be necessary, is appropriated out of any money to the credit of the General Fund, and allocated in a manner as determined by the Treasurer's Office, to defray the expenses of the Office of the Secretary of State for the period upon passage, and ending

June 30, 2025.................................. $   3,977,000.00.

     This additional appropriation is for the purpose of defraying the expenses of software system updates and upgrades.

SECTION 9.  In addition to all other sums herein appropriated, the following sum, or so much thereof as may be necessary, is appropriated out of any money to the credit of the Capital Expense Fund and allocated in a manner as determined by the Treasurer's Office to defray the expenses of the Mississippi Department of Education for the period beginning July 1, 2023, and ending June 30, 2024 $   2,515,260.00.

     This additional appropriation is provided for the purpose of defraying the costs of the Educable Child program.

SECTION 10.  In addition to all other sums herein appropriated, the following sum, or so much thereof as may be necessary, is appropriated out of any money to the credit of the Capital Expense Fund and allocated in a manner as determined by the Treasurer's Office to defray the expenses of the Mississippi State Department of Health for the period beginning upon passage, and ending June 30, 2025 $   2,772,010.00.

     This additional appropriation is provided for defraying the costs of legal expenses associated with the City of Jackson's water litigation.

     SECTION 11.  This act shall take effect and be in force from and after its passage.
